Multi-view Attention for gestational age at birth prediction

Abstract

We present our method for gestational age at birth prediction for the SLCN (surface learning for clinical neuroimaging) challenge. Our method is based on a multi-view shape analysis technique that captures 2D renderings of a 3D object from different viewpoints. We render the brain features on the surface of the sphere and then the 2D images are analyzed via 2D CNNs and an attention layer for the regression task. The regression task achieves a MAE of 1.637 +- 1.3 on the Native space and MAE of 1.38 +- 1.14 on the template space.
